unicode是什么(utf8编码对照表)

1、什么是域名?域名,我们现在都知道是什么了(比如fuyeor.com和fuyeor.cn就叫域名)。fuyeor.cn和fuyeor.com一样,用点号隔开的

1、什么是域名?

域名,我们现在都知道是什么了(比如fuyeor.com和fuyeor.cn就叫域名)。

unicode是什么(utf8编码对照表)插图

fuyeor.cn和fuyeor.com一样,用点号隔开的叫域名。

一些国际域名(IDN)已经支持多语言字母表,如西里尔字母(如фуиеор.com,ууиеор。рф)和中国人(像Fuyue.com Fuyue.com)

什么域名后缀是.р ф?docs.fuyeor.com/answer/5877.html

unicode是什么(utf8编码对照表)插图(1)

2、那么中文域名是什么?

所以既然有西里尔文域名(像фуиеор.com,ууиеор。рф)和其他语言中的特殊字符(如Fuyé or.com),当然也有中文域名[1]

中文域名有两种。中文域名一般指含有汉字的域名,可以指:

国际化域名(IDN),可含有中文字的域名,(类似 复玥.com 复玥.cn 这样的域名);以及国际化国家及地区顶级域(IDN ccTLD),可含有中文字的顶级域,例如.中国、.香港 、.台湾 、.网址等。

unicode是什么(utf8编码对照表)插图(2)

使用中文域名时,需要通过Punycode [2]进行转码才能正常显示。

3、Punycode 转码

什么是中文域名转码?

中文域名是一个新的顶级域名,目前标准解析服务器不支持。因为操作系统核心和DNS解析服务器都是英文代码交换,所以DNS服务器上不支持直接中文域名解析。所有的中文域名都需要转换成Punycode代码,然后通过DNS解析Punycode代码。

比如《傅月》的转码。网址”是:xn xn - yrsu23d.xn - ses554g

什么是Punycode转码?

Punycode是一种基于RFC 3492标准的编码系统,主要用于将域名从本地语言采用的Unicode编码转换成可以在DNS系统中使用的编码。Punycode由26个字母、10个阿拉伯数字和符号“-”组成。

为什么浏览器显示中文域名不需要转码?

目前各种浏览器都完美支持中文域名,但浏览器中主动加入了中文域名自动转码,实现了地址栏的中文显示。

另外,中文域名的使用和普通域名没有太大区别,就是有些云产品可能无法使用(比如腾讯云的CDN不支持使用中文域名)

中文域名是什么?docs.fuyeor.com/answer/8717.html#answer-8718

unicode是什么(utf8编码对照表)插图(3)

参考^中文域名是什么? https://docs.fuyeor.com/answer/8717.html^IDN 域名的 Punycode 转码是什么 https://docs.fuyeor.com/answer/8715.html

免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。

作者:美站资讯,如若转载,请注明出处:https://www.meizw.com/n/110436.html

发表回复

登录后才能评论